Businesses and residents in Greene, Monroe, Brown, Jackson, Lawrence, Morgan and Owen counties may qualify for low interest disaster loans from the U.S. Small Business Administration following damage incurred from storms that rolled through Indiana on May 16th.
Beginning Monday, June 23rd, the SBA and the Indiana Department of Homeland Security will operate a Disaster Loan Outreach Center in Greene County to assist residents in filing claims and answering questions regarding potential assistance to recover from damage.
The center is for those impacted by the May 16th storms only.
The Disaster Loan Outreach Center will be open through the 28th at the Greene County Events Center East End Business Offices, 45-03 West State Road in Bloomfield.
Hours of operation will be 9:00 AM to 6:00 PM Monday, June 23rd through the 25th, Noon until 8:00 PM on June 26th and from 9:00 AM until 6:00 PM June 27th and 28th.
SBA Customer Service representatives will be on hand at the DLOC to answer questions about the loan program and help with applications.
